[0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of silage harvesting, in particular to a self-propelled all-in-one silage harvesting and baling machine. Background Art

[0002] The silage harvester and baler is a key piece of equipment for silage harvesting. It integrates harvesting, crushing and baling functions, which can greatly improve efficiency and reduce costs. It is widely used in large-scale planting and can quickly complete crop harvesting, preliminary processing and baling, facilitating subsequent storage and utilization.

[0003] The core of its design is to efficiently complete harvesting and baling, and there is a lack of targeted treatment of surface stubble tips. The knives mostly cut the middle and upper parts of the plants to separate the usable parts, and the stubble tips close to the surface remain intact or even without substantial damage. This low-destructive operation mode keeps the stubble tips intact, the underground root system is not significantly disturbed, and water and nutrients are continuously transported to form "living residues", which significantly delays natural decay and decomposition.

[0004] The existing equipment has a large cutting gap, and the blade angle is suitable for straw separation rather than stubble tip crushing. In order to avoid wear and tear of the blade entering the soil, a higher ground clearance is reserved, so that the stubble tip is not cut off and crushed. The root system is intact and maintains vigorous physiological activity. The intact epidermis and vascular bundles hinder the invasion and colonization of microorganisms. Refractory components such as lignin lose the physical destruction force, and the decomposition efficiency is greatly reduced. At the same time, the upright undamaged stubble tip has a small contact area with the soil, and microbial attachment and moisture retention are limited, further hindering decomposition.

[0005] During tillage, intact stubble tips can easily entangle agricultural machinery, increasing resistance, leading to uneven tillage, reduced soil fineness, increased energy consumption and the risk of failure. During the planting process, the remaining stubble tips compete for nutrients, slowing the growth of seedlings, and the undecomposed residues form a physical barrier, affecting seed germination and root penetration. In terms of disease and pest control, intact stubble tips provide a stable overwintering environment for pathogens and pests, increasing the probability of the next crop being infected with the disease.

[0026] 1. The present invention provides extrusion plates. When the machine frame moves, the remaining stubble tips on the ground enter the space between the two extrusion plates. The sliding support box drives the extrusion plates to slide and squeeze the stubble tips. Simultaneously, the counter-rotating rotating disks and the inclined rubbing teeth on the surfaces of the extrusion plates cooperate with each other to destroy the epidermis and cell walls of the stubble tips, loosening their tissue and damaging their integrity. The stubble tips can also be rubbed and torn to increase the surface area and expose the internal tissue. Subsequently, a diluted EM bacterial solution is applied to the treated stubble tips. The loose structure and exposed tissue of the stubble tips can be utilized to allow beneficial microorganisms in the EM bacterial solution to quickly attach, colonize, and multiply in large numbers, accelerating the decomposition of organic matter. Combined with the easily decomposable conditions formed by mechanical treatment, the decay time is further shortened and harmful products of corruption are reduced.

[0027] 2. The invention arranges a guide cylinder, an elastically mounted knocking pin and a spring on the inner wall of the support box, and utilizes the rotation of the transmission disk to drive the pressing pin to press the transmission plate, so that the knocking pin slides and is reset with the help of elastic force and hits the inner wall of the support box to generate vibration, and the vibration can be transmitted to the extrusion plate. When the stubble tip is squeezed, this vibration can aggravate the internal cell rupture, further fragment the treated loose tissue to reduce the fiber toughness, and at the same time enhance the friction and tearing between the stubble tip and the extrusion plate and rubbing bevel teeth, avoid local residual intact tissue, and more thoroughly destroy its physical structure to facilitate microbial decomposition. In addition, the vibration can also create more fine gaps in the stubble tip, disperse the loose tissue to reduce obstruction, promote the penetration and diffusion of EM bacterial solution, allow the bacterial solution to contact the damaged tissue more evenly, increase the contact area between beneficial microorganisms and decomposable components, facilitate microbial colonization and reproduction, improve the efficiency of bacterial solution, and thus accelerate the decay of the stubble tip. [0041] In order to make the technical means, creative features, objectives and effects achieved by the present invention easier to understand, the present invention is further described below in conjunction with specific implementation methods.

[0042] like Figures 1 to 11 As shown, the self-propelled silage harvesting and baling machine described in the present invention includes a moving part, a harvesting part, a supporting part, a squeezing mechanism and a kneading mechanism.

[0043] The moving part includes a frame 1 and a support bucket 2. The support bucket 2 is arranged on one side of the frame 1. The frame 1 has a built-in diesel engine and a crawler on the side. A baler for baling silage is arranged in the frame 1. The harvested silage is transferred to the baler to realize baling of the silage.

[0044] The harvesting part includes a support platform 8, a rotating roller 3 and a guide tooth 4. The support platform 8 is fixedly mounted on the inner wall of the support bucket 2, and the rotating roller 3 is rotatably mounted on the upper end of the support platform 8. The support platform 8 provides support for the rotating roller 3, wherein the power for the rotation of the rotating roller 3 is provided by a diesel engine.

[0045] A harvesting blade is provided on the outer wall of the rotating roller 3, and the guide teeth 4 are fixedly installed on the radial outer wall of the rotating roller 3. In this embodiment, two rotating rollers 3 are provided, and the rotation directions of the two rotating rollers 3 are opposite. When harvesting, the silage is cut by the harvesting blade, and then the silage is transported to the rear of the support bucket 2 through the guide teeth 4 so as to be transported to the inside of the baler.

[0046] The supporting portion includes an installation box 7 and a support box 6 slidably arranged on one side of the installation box 7 . The installation box 7 is fixedly mounted on the bottom surface of the support platform 8 , and the installation box 7 provides support for the support box 6 .

[0047] The squeezing mechanism includes a squeezing plate 5 , a crossbeam 15 and a connecting rod 13 , wherein one side of the squeezing plate 5 is configured to be arc-shaped so that the stubble tips remaining on the bottom surface can enter between the two squeezing plates 5 during harvesting.

[0048] The crossbeam 15 is elastically mounted on the inner wall of the mounting box 7. The side wall of the crossbeam 15 is connected to the support box 6 through a connecting rod 13. One end of the connecting rod 13 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the crossbeam 15. The other end of the connecting rod 13 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the support box 6. The support box 6 is driven to slide by sliding the crossbeam 15.

[0049] The outer wall of the extrusion plate 5 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the support box 6. During the movement of the frame 1, the stubble tips remaining on the ground enter between the two extrusion plates 5. At this time, the extrusion plate 5 is driven to slide by the sliding support box 6, thereby squeezing the stubble tips, which can destroy the wax layer and dense tissue on the surface of the stubble tips, making it easier for them to contact with microorganisms and moisture in the surrounding environment, accelerating the colonization and reproduction of microorganisms. In addition, the damaged structure can also promote the exudation of juice inside the stubble tips, providing nutrition for microorganisms, thereby accelerating the decomposition process, effectively shortening the decay time of the stubble tips, reducing their residual period in the field, reducing the hidden dangers of diseases and pests caused by long-term non-decay, and facilitating subsequent farming.

[0050] The kneading mechanism includes a rotating disk 11 and kneading bevel teeth 12. The rotating disk 11 rotates on the inner wall of the extrusion plate 5, and the kneading bevel teeth 12 are fixedly installed on the outer wall of the rotating disk 11. The two rotating disks 11 rotate in opposite directions. When the extrusion plate 5 extrude the stubble tip, the rotating rotating disk 11 rubs the extruded stubble tip through the kneading bevel teeth 12.

[0051] When harvesting silage, the stubble tips remaining on the bottom surface are placed between the two squeezing plates 5. By the two squeezing plates 5 being close to each other and squeezing in conjunction with the counter-rotating rotating disk 11 inside the squeezing plates 5 and the inclined kneading teeth 12 on its surface, the squeezing of the squeezing plates 5 can not only destroy the epidermis and cell wall of the stubble tips, making the tissue loose and the integrity damaged, but also knead and tear the stubble tips through the counter-rotating rotating disk 11 and the kneading teeth 12, further increasing its surface area and fully exposing the internal tissue, making it easier to absorb moisture and contact microorganisms, while promoting the attachment, colonization and metabolic activities of microorganisms, accelerating the decomposition of organic matter in the stubble tips, and further shortening the decay time.

[0052] A storage box 20 for storing bacterial liquid is fixedly mounted on the outer wall of the supporting bucket 2. In this embodiment, the bacterial liquid is EM bacterial liquid diluent (EM bacterial liquid: water = 1: 100-200).

[0053] An elastic block 21 is fixedly mounted on the inner wall of the support box 6. A cavity is provided inside the elastic block 21, and an input pipe and an output pipe are provided outside. Both the input pipe and the output pipe of the elastic block 21 are provided with a one-way valve, and the conduction directions are opposite. When the elastic block 21 is pressed back and forth, the external liquid enters the interior of the elastic block 21 through the input pipe, and the liquid inside the elastic block 21 is discharged through the output pipe.

[0054] A drainage hole 10 is fixedly installed on the side wall of the rotating disk 11, and a transfer groove 19 connected to the drainage hole 10 is provided on the inner wall of the extrusion plate 5. When the rotating disk 11 rotates, the drainage hole 10 remains connected to the transfer groove 19, and a sealed bearing is provided at the contact position between the rotating disk 11 and the extrusion plate 5.

[0055] The output pipe of the elastic block 21 is connected to the adapter groove 19, and the input pipe of the elastic block 21 is connected to the inner cavity of the storage box 20. When squeezing and kneading the stubble tips remaining on the ground, the elastic block 21 is squeezed back and forth to extract the bacterial liquid inside the storage box 20 and discharge it through the drainage hole 10, so that the stubble tips destroyed by kneading and squeezing come into contact with the bacterial liquid.

[0056] Applying a diluted EM bacterial solution to the stubble tips after they have been treated by the squeezing plate 5 and the kneading bevel teeth 12 of the rotating disk 11 can take advantage of the destroyed loose structure and exposed internal tissue of the stubble tips, allowing beneficial microorganisms (such as lactic acid bacteria and yeasts) in the EM bacterial solution to attach, colonize, and multiply more rapidly. These microorganisms inhibit the growth of putrefactive bacteria by competing for nutrients and space, while accelerating the decomposition of organic matter in the stubble tips. Combined with the easy decomposition conditions already present in the stubble tips due to mechanical treatment, the decay time is further shortened and the production of harmful products during the decay process is reduced.

[0057] As a preferred embodiment of the present invention, a transmission rod 9 is rotatably mounted on the inner wall of the installation box 7 , and a pressing cam 14 is fixedly mounted on the radial outer wall of the transmission rod 9 . Rotating the transmission rod 9 drives the pressing cam 14 to rotate.

[0058] The radial outer wall of the pressing cam 14 slides in contact with the outer wall of the cross beam 15. When the pressing cam 14 rotates, it presses the cross beam 15, and cooperates with the elastic force exerted on the cross beam 15 to control the reciprocating sliding of the cross beam 15, thereby controlling the reciprocating sliding of the extrusion plate 5 to achieve the extrusion of the burr tip.

[0059] The axial end of the transmission rod 9 is connected to the center position of the axial end of the rotating roller 3 through gear cooperation, so that when the rotating roller 3 rotates, the transmission rod 9 is controlled to rotate through the gear cooperation to provide power for the extrusion plate 5 to extrude the stubble tip. The reason why the rotating roller 3 adopts gear cooperation to control the rotation of the transmission rod 9 is to achieve differential rotation between the rotating roller 3 and the transmission rod 9.

[0060] A transmission shaft 18 is fixedly installed at the center position of the axial end of the rotating disk 11. Rotating the transmission shaft 18 drives the rotating disk 11 and the rubbing bevel teeth 12 to rotate. One end of the transmission shaft 18 extends to the inner wall of the mounting box 7, thereby improving the destruction efficiency of the stubble tip when the extrusion plate 5 squeezes the stubble tip, thereby reducing the time for the stubble tip to rot.

[0061] During the sliding of the crossbeam 15, the support box 6 and the extrusion plate 5 are driven to move synchronously, and at the same time, the transmission shaft 18 is driven to slide. A spiral groove 16 is provided on the radial outer wall of the transmission shaft 18, and a guide ball 17 is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the mounting box 7. The outer wall of the guide ball 17 slides in contact with the inner wall of the spiral groove 16. During the sliding of the transmission shaft 18, the rotation of the transmission shaft 18 is controlled by the cooperation of the guide ball 17 and the spiral groove 16, thereby controlling the rotation of the rotating disk 11, and then when the extrusion plate 5 extrude the stubble tip, the stubble tip is rotated and kneaded by the rotating disk 11.

[0062] As a preferred embodiment of the present invention, a transmission disk 22 is installed on the inner wall of the support box 6 through a torsion spring. One end of the torsion spring is fixed to the outer wall of the transmission disk 22, and the other end of the torsion spring is fixed to the inner wall of the support box 6. After rotating the transmission disk 22, the elastic force of the torsion spring is used to control the transmission disk 22 to reset.

[0063] A transmission cylinder 35 is fixedly mounted on the bottom surface of the transmission disc 22 , and a pressing block 32 is fixedly mounted on the radial outer wall of the transmission cylinder 35 . When the transmission disc 22 rotates, the transmission cylinder 35 and the pressing block 32 are driven to rotate synchronously.

[0064] A support plate 26 is fixedly mounted on the outer wall of the elastic block 21. The support plate 26 is used to support the elastic block 21. A transmission block 34 is fixedly mounted on the outer wall of the support plate 26. The pressing block 32 is used to press the transmission block 34. When the transmission cylinder 35 rotates, the pressing block 32 is driven to rotate, and then the pressing transmission block 34 presses the elastic block 21 through the support plate 26. After the pressing block 32 is separated from the transmission block 34, the elastic block 21 is reset, thereby realizing the reciprocating deformation of the elastic block 21, which is used to control the discharge of the bacterial liquid from the drainage hole 10.

[0065] A support frame 28 is fixedly mounted on the inner wall of the support box 6 , and a guide rod 27 is slidably mounted on the inner wall of the support frame 28 . The support frame 28 provides guidance and support for the guide rod 27 .

[0066] One end of the guide rod 27 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the support plate 26, and the side wall of the support frame 28 is connected to the support plate 26 through an elastic member. The elastic member is a spring, one end of the spring is connected to the support plate 26, and the other end is fixed to the support frame 28. Through the action of the spring force, the auxiliary elastic block 21 recovers its deformation and maintains the efficiency of bacterial liquid transportation.

[0067] A take-up roller 24 is fixedly mounted on the upper end surface of the drive disc 22. A traction rope 23 is wound around the radially outer wall of the take-up roller 24. One end of the traction rope 23 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the take-up roller 24. Pulling the traction rope 23 controls the rotation of the take-up roller 24. The axis of the take-up roller 24 rotates with the drive disc 22. Pulling the traction rope 23 drives the drive disc 22 to rotate. When the traction rope 23 is released, the drive disc 22 returns to its original position via a torsion spring, and the take-up roller 24 rotates in the opposite direction, rewinding the traction rope 23.

[0068] The other end of the traction rope 23 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the transmission shaft 18. When the extrusion plate 5 squeezes the stubble tip, the transmission shaft 18 slides and the winding roller 24 is pulled to rotate by the traction rope 23. At this time, the transmission disk 22 is driven to rotate, and the transmission block 34 is pushed by the top pressure block 32, thereby realizing the extrusion of the elastic block 21. When the extrusion plate 5 slides back and forth, the transmission shaft 18 is driven to slide back and forth. The elastic force of the transmission disk 22 causes it to deflect back and forth, realizing the reciprocating extrusion of the elastic block 21, and realizing the synchronous discharge of the bacterial liquid when squeezing the stubble tip.

[0069] The outer wall of the winding roller 24 is elastically installed with a clamping roller 36 for clamping the traction rope 23, wherein multiple clamping rollers 36 are arranged in a ring shape along the axis of the winding roller 24, and the outer wall of the clamping roller 36 has a tendency to fit with the outer wall of the traction rope 23, thereby clamping the traction rope 23 and preventing the traction rope 23 from falling off.

[0070] A guide cylinder 30 is fixedly mounted on the inner wall of the support box 6 , a knock pin 29 is elastically mounted on the inner wall of the guide cylinder 30 , a spring is provided on the inner wall of the guide cylinder 30 , one end of the spring is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the knock pin 29 .

[0071] When the extrusion plate 5 squeezes the burr tip, the knock pin 29 is pulled and then released, and the knock pin 29 hits the inner wall of the support box 6 to generate vibration, which is transmitted to the extrusion plate 5.

[0072] The stubble tip is subjected to vibration while being squeezed, which can, on the one hand, aggravate the rupture of the internal cell structure of the stubble tip, further break up the tissue that has been loosened after being squeezed and kneaded by the oblique teeth 12, and reduce the toughness of the fiber. On the other hand, it can generate more sufficient friction and tearing between the stubble tip and the extrusion plate 5 and the kneading oblique teeth 12 of the rotating disk 11, avoiding the residual intact tissue in some parts due to uneven force, thereby more thoroughly destroying the physical structure of the stubble tip, making it easier to be decomposed by microorganisms, and indirectly accelerating the decay rate.

[0073] At the same time, vibration creates more tiny gaps and pores inside the stubble tip, further disperses the loose tissue, and reduces the obstruction of dense blocks. This vibration can also promote the penetration and diffusion of EM bacterial solution dilution inside the stubble tip, allowing the bacterial solution to more evenly contact the damaged tissue and internal structure of the stubble tip, increasing the contact area between beneficial microorganisms and the decomposable components of the stubble tip, and creating a more favorable environment for microbial colonization and reproduction, thereby improving the efficiency of the bacterial solution and accelerating the decay of the stubble tip.

[0074] The outer wall of the knocking pin 29 is fixedly installed with a connecting plate 31, and the outer wall of the connecting plate 31 is fixedly installed with a transmission plate 33. The side wall of the transmission plate 33 is inclined. The outer wall of the transmission disk 22 is fixedly installed with a pressing pin 25 for pressing the transmission plate 33. Rotating the transmission disk 22 drives the pressing pin 25 to rotate, and the pressing pin 25 presses the inclined surface of the transmission plate 33, thereby driving the connecting plate 31 and the knocking pin 29 to slide. After the pressing pin 25 is separated from the transmission plate 33, the knocking pin 29 is reset by elastic force to achieve knocking on the inner wall of the support box 6.
